Waze Unveils AI-Powered Updates for Personalized, Less Distracting Navigation Experience
July 13, 2026
Waze is rolling out AI-driven updates designed to reduce driver distractions and deliver a more personalized navigation experience, including a new “less chatty” mode that minimizes nonessential prompts and auto-prioritized routing based on a driver’s history.
The changes align with Google’s Gemini strategy and position Waze in competition with rivals like Apple Maps, expanding Gemini-powered features across the app.
The features are rolling out globally on Android and iOS now, with Motorcycle mode already live in select countries and expanding to more regions.
Updates apply to US and global Android and iOS users, with Gemini destination search in beta to boost natural language queries.
A beta conversational tool is being tested that can handle spoken queries to find open restaurants or parking and return a list of options.
Gemini powers natural-language destination searches and quick chat-driven queries, letting users find places like coffee shops, gas stations with low prices, or nearby parking, with results shown as a list.

A dedicated Motorcycle mode uses AI to optimize two-wheeler routes, account for two-wheeler hazards, and provide more accurate ETAs in multiple countries, supported by real-time data and editors.
Motorcycle mode is rolling out in Mexico, Brazil, Argentina, Malaysia, Peru, and the Philippines, with no announced US timeline.
